get EMP:
- atmospheric fission (I don't know if fusion works as well) detonations
- BIG spark-gap transmittors, close to the thing.
- explosive compression (via, of course, explosives) of superconducting?
wire coils with current moving through them.
There may well be other methods that aren't practical today; the second
two are generally used to test equipment for tolerance against the first.
The best bet for 2050+ is probably the third, although I'd be surprised
if you got it under briefcase-sized for any decent field of effect.
